No, I did not shape them like goldfish, but they are puffy and crisp like the real thing.
- 1 c flour
- 1 tsp salt
- 1 tsp baking powder
- 1 tsp sugar
- 1/4 c cheddar cheese powder
- 2 tbsp butter
- 3/4 c cold water
Stir flour, salt, baking powder, sugar and cheese powder together until fully mixed. Use a pastry knife or fork to cut butter into mixture until you have pea size crumbs. Add water and stir to combine with rubber spatula or use your hands to fully mix. Move to flour dusted counter and knead dough for 5 minutes. Wrap in plastic wrap and refrigerate 8 hours to overnight.
Preheat oven to 400 degrees.
Dust work surface or a sheet of parchment paper thoroughly with flour. Shape dough into a rectangle. Roll out til about 1/4 inch thickness. Use pizza cutter, knife or pastry knife to cut into approximately 1 inch squares. Spread pieces out so they won’t stick together while baking. I usually split them between two pans.
Bake for 15 minutes. I recommend rotating your pan(s) halfway through baking for more even crisping. Remove and let them completely cool. They will continue to crisp up as they cool.
